Foros del Web » Creando para Internet » Flash y Actionscript »

Asp+flash+access.

Estas en el tema de Asp+flash+access. en el foro de Flash y Actionscript en Foros del Web. hola, alquien sabe com ohacer para mostrar en un swf en internet datos desde una base de datos con asp.. pero de forma ordenada, me ...
  #1 (permalink)  
Antiguo 09/08/2004, 19:36
Avatar de lexus  
Fecha de Ingreso: enero-2002
Ubicación: Cali - Colombia
Mensajes: 2.234
Antigüedad: 22 años, 10 meses
Puntos: 4
Exclamación Asp+flash+access.

hola, alquien sabe com ohacer para mostrar en un swf en internet datos desde una base de datos con asp..
pero de forma ordenada, me refiero a mostrar datos de 5 en 5 por ejemplo con una paginacion..
ASP+FLASH+ACCESS.
espero me puedan colaborar.
gracias
__________________
Control de Visitantes, Control de Accesos, Minutas digitales, Manejo de Correspondencia
http://www.controldevisitantes.com
  #2 (permalink)  
Antiguo 10/08/2004, 05:41
Avatar de Parzival  
Fecha de Ingreso: junio-2004
Ubicación: Vive en el foro
Mensajes: 190
Antigüedad: 20 años, 5 meses
Puntos: 2
Lo que debes hacer es tener un script en ASP que haga la búsqueda en la base de datos, y gracias a un "for" o un "while" que escriba en un txt algo así como esto:

num=(numero de datos a mostrar)&dato1=(info, datos o lo que sea)&dato2=idem

así hasta cumplir el número de datos indicados en la variable num.

Luego desde flash lo lees con el "loadvars()", en la ayuda y en el manual de referencia tienes unos ejemplos bastante claros de como funciona eso.

Parece complicado, pero te aconsejaría que probases ;)
  #3 (permalink)  
Antiguo 10/08/2004, 07:02
Avatar de lexus  
Fecha de Ingreso: enero-2002
Ubicación: Cali - Colombia
Mensajes: 2.234
Antigüedad: 22 años, 10 meses
Puntos: 4
gracias,. tengo varios ejemplos qieu he descargado para probar de leer desde access con asp.. pero en ninguno vi algo para paginar, que si por ejemplo tengo 50 registrosy quiero ver solo 10 por cada pagina me salga abajo asi_: paginas: 1 2 3 4 5....

espero me puedan colaborar.gracias
__________________
Control de Visitantes, Control de Accesos, Minutas digitales, Manejo de Correspondencia
http://www.controldevisitantes.com
  #4 (permalink)  
Antiguo 10/08/2004, 08:15
Avatar de Parzival  
Fecha de Ingreso: junio-2004
Ubicación: Vive en el foro
Mensajes: 190
Antigüedad: 20 años, 5 meses
Puntos: 2
eso lo haces con el recordset... vaya, ahora me acuerdo de php y no de asp, lo miré hace tiempo xD

Pero desde flash le pasas el numero de pagina de forma GET en la ruta del archivo y la recuperas desde asp (esto sabrás hacerlo), luego multiplicas ese numero por 10 y lo guardas en la variable "campos", por ejemplo.

Luego con un "for i = 1 to campos" vas recorriendo los recordsets hasta que i sea igual o mayor que campos-10 que es cuando los recorres y además te quedas con ellos y los escribes en el archivo de la forma que te dije antes "varn=tal&varn+1cual".

A ver si así mejor, es un poco lioso, pero weno... ;)
  #5 (permalink)  
Antiguo 10/08/2004, 10:22
Avatar de lexus  
Fecha de Ingreso: enero-2002
Ubicación: Cali - Colombia
Mensajes: 2.234
Antigüedad: 22 años, 10 meses
Puntos: 4
ok. muchas gracias, intentare hacerlo, de todos modos me gustaria ver uno ya hecho para basarme en el.. espero alguien haya hecho algo parecido..
gracias.
__________________
Control de Visitantes, Control de Accesos, Minutas digitales, Manejo de Correspondencia
http://www.controldevisitantes.com
  #6 (permalink)  
Antiguo 10/08/2004, 16:09
Avatar de Parzival  
Fecha de Ingreso: junio-2004
Ubicación: Vive en el foro
Mensajes: 190
Antigüedad: 20 años, 5 meses
Puntos: 2
Yo ya te digo, que para la página de http://www.xercas.com es lo que hicimos, le pasaba cuantos campos había en total en la base de datos que cumplían los requisitos por una variable, y luego cogía así lo que nos interesaba.

Si no busca simplemente por google, paginación en ASP o algo así.
  #7 (permalink)  
Antiguo 10/08/2004, 20:30
Avatar de lexus  
Fecha de Ingreso: enero-2002
Ubicación: Cali - Colombia
Mensajes: 2.234
Antigüedad: 22 años, 10 meses
Puntos: 4
si, yo paginacion en asp lo se hacer pero nunca lo he visto en flash, espero me puedan ayudar ya que no se mucho de flash qeu digamos gracias....
__________________
Control de Visitantes, Control de Accesos, Minutas digitales, Manejo de Correspondencia
http://www.controldevisitantes.com
  #8 (permalink)  
Antiguo 11/08/2004, 01:06
Avatar de Parzival  
Fecha de Ingreso: junio-2004
Ubicación: Vive en el foro
Mensajes: 190
Antigüedad: 20 años, 5 meses
Puntos: 2
Mira, el código para pasarle los datos a flash desde PHP es algo así:

$basedatos = mysql_connect("localhost", "basedatos");
mysql_select_db("basedatos",$basedatos);

$result = mysql_query("SELECT COUNT(*) FROM tabla");
$contador = mysql_fetch_array($result);
$imprimir = "var0=".$contador[0];
$result = mysql_query("SELECT * FROM tabla");
$i=1;
while ($myrow = mysql_fetch_array($result))
{
$imprimir = $imprimir."&var".$i."=".$myrow['id']."&var".(++$i)."=".$myrow['campo1']." X ".$myrow['campo2'];
$i++;
}
print $imprimir;

Luego en el flash tengo en cuenta en qué página voy, y lo multiplico el número de elementos que voy mostrando en cada una, así ya sé en qué número de variable tendría que ir. Entiendes?

No es ASP, pero espero que te des guiado igual...
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 16:20.